  • In fact, yes, HID is one of the standard chip types. and yes, one of the cloneable ones. so if you can access proxmark3, a RFIDLER or maybe one of the cheap chinese cloners I'm currently testing, you should be able to copy it to one of the re-writable implants.

  • The T5577 and ATA5577 are the thing. ATA is the IC manufacturer part number and T5577 is what packaged chips are called.
